Bitcoin: Market Reacts as BTC Tests $100K Level
Thursday saw a sudden pullback across the cryptocurrency market, with Bitcoin (BTC) testing support near $100,000. This marked a bearish break from the recent uptrend and spurred panic-driven selling across several altcoins.
BTC dropped sharply from its recent highs and found support at the 50-day Exponential Moving Average (EMA) near $100,860. At the time of writing, Bitcoin is trading at $101,724, attempting to recover and retest the neckline near $102,250.
Technical analysts noted a breakdown from a Head-and-Shoulders pattern, typically a bearish reversal setup. This led to a round of profit booking in popular altcoins like Lido DAO (LDO), Jupiter (JUP), and Artificial Superintelligence Alliance (FET).
